Rathbone Greenbank questions BP's oil sands project

17th April 2008

Rathbone Greenbank joined with a coalition of investors to raise concerns at BP’s Annual General Meeting over the company’s re-entry into the Canadian oil sands project. Jointly presenting the statement with the ECCR, Rathbone Greenbank raised important questions about the long-term environmental impacts of this highly intensive form of oil extraction, and the future costs to the company should expensive carbon capture technology have to be fitted to the project. Complementing the coalition on their reasoned approach, BP Chairman Peter Sutherland stressed the company’s ongoing commitment to leadership on renewable and sustainable energy solutions.
